#3238d4 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#3238d4 is composed of 19.6% red, 22%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.4% cyan, 73.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 237.8 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 51.4%. #3238d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#6470ff with #0000a9.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

● #3238d4 color description : Strong blue.
The hexadecimal color #3238d4 has RGB values of R:50, G:56,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 3291348.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010106 is the darkest color, while #f5f5fd is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7f88 is the less saturated color, while #0c15fa is the most saturated one.
